HRC specifications

AttributeRange / Standard
ProductHot rolled coil and sheet, non-alloy steel
Thickness0.8 mm – 12.0 mm
Width1210 / 1250 / 1500 mm
GradesQ195, Q235B, 1006 soft grade (GB/T 700); SS400 (JIS G3101); A36 (ASTM A36/A36M)
SurfaceMill finish with scale, or pickled and oiled (HRPO)
EdgeMill edge or slit edge
PCT heading72.08 (flat-rolled, hot-rolled, width 600 mm or more)
CertificationMill test certificate to EN 10204 (type as agreed at order)

Hot rolled coil grades and what they are used for

GradeStandardTypical use
Q195GB/T 700Low-strength forming, light sections, general fabrication
Q215GB/T 700General structural work where Q235 strength is not required
Q235BGB/T 700The common structural grade — pipe, tube, frames, general structure
SS400JIS G3101Japanese-standard structural equivalent, broadly comparable to Q235B
A36ASTM A36/A36MAmerican-standard structural plate and shapes

How hot rolled coil is used in Pakistan

Pakistan has no operating hot strip mill, so every tonne of hot rolled coil consumed in the country is imported. HRC arrives either as finished product for fabrication, or as the substrate that domestic mills pickle and cold-roll into cold rolled coil and then galvanise into GP coil.

The largest domestic uses are welded pipe and tube, structural fabrication and frames, and general engineering work. Thickness and grade selection is usually driven by the welding and forming the fabricator intends to do, rather than by price alone.

Duty position on hot rolled coil

Hot rolled coil is the one flat steel product in Pakistan that carries no anti-dumping duty from any origin. That is not true of cold rolled, galvanised or colour coated coil, all of which carry anti-dumping measures on Chinese material.
